Here are your entertainment news highlights from this past week: August 20 - 24, 2007

Monday: Tom Cruise is over in Germany filming his next movie, Valkyrie, where the police are only concerned with the safety of “anyone famous.”

Tuesday: Michael Bay decided he didn’t like Paramount’s “No Blu-ray” decision and declared he wouldn’t do Transformers 2 as a result. He recanted a day later with his tail between his legs.


Wednesday: BioShock was released for the XBOX 360 and PC. This definitely looks like it’s going to be a really cool, dark game.

Thursday: Britney Spears just might be moving over to England to hide from her grubby hubby and court decisions over her kids.

Friday: Six new movies came rolling into theaters today. Not that any of them are knock outs, but it should at least keep us busy all weekend.
